Aluminium General
Aluminium has a very good weight to strength ratio and is used extensively in all fields of engineering.
Aluminium is the most commonly occurring metal on the planet and is the most widely used metal after steel, it is none toxic and is used widely with food and pharmaceutical products. Aluminium is also a good reflector of light and this can be improved by having the aluminium sheet polished.

Aluminium Tread Plate
Also known as Tread Plate, Floor Plate, Chequer Plate, Checker Plate, Chequered Floor Plate, Checker Plate and Check Plate.
Chequer Plate has many applications but its main use is for protection. Its decorative and industrial appearance also generates interest with designers and it can often be found included in architecture and the decor of buildings.
It is a very hard wearing and strong grade of aluminium, Alloy 5754, it has excellent corrosion resistance and will withstand sea water and much pollution. Grade 5754 is excellent for welding and cold working.
Typical applications for Chequer Plate
- Floor Covering for hygiene and slip resistance
- Wall and Column Protection to prevent impact damage where hand trucks, trolleys, sack carts etc are operated.
- Door Protection as kick plates or as a full door cladding
- Commercial Vehicle and Vans
- Access Ramp covering for wheelchairs
- Livestock Trailer tailgate ramps and flooring.
- Land rover and other 4 x 4 Off Road Vehicle body protection, bonnets, wings, sills, corners, floors, bumpers, mud flaps, door plates, side plates, load area plates
- Truck Bed Tool Boxes
- Stair Treads, Step Ladders, Walkways
- Shop Front fascias for vandal protection
Plain Semi Bright
Metal Sheets stock of plain aluminium sheet comprises mainly of alloy grade 1050. It is commercially pure aluminium and is resistant to chemical attack and weathering. It is easy to cold work and weld.
Grade 1050 is used extensively in general fabrication and for architectural products such as flashings, pressings, cills, soffits and cappings because of its ease of fabrication and excellent powder coating qualities.
Aluminium sheet metal is an excellent substrate for painting and powder coating, polyester powder coated aluminium with correct pretreatment is used in architectural applications with guarantees in excess of 25 years.

The table below shows the various grades of aluminium alloys
Aluminium Series | Alloying Elements | Grade References |
---|---|---|
1000 Series | Pure Aluminium | 1050 / 1200 |
2000 Series | Copper | 2014 |
3000 Series | Manganese | 3013 |
4000 Series | Silicon | 4343 / 4015 |
5000 Series | Magnesium | 5251 |
6000 Series | Magnesium | 6063 / 6082 |
8000 Series | Others |
